

AI绘画 一键AI绘画生成器
热销榜AI绘画榜·第2名
一键AI绘画是一款AI图片处理工具,通过AI绘画功能输入画面的关键词软件便会通过AI算法自动绘画,除此之外软件还带有图片格式转换、图片编辑、老照片修复等常用图片处理功能
上海互盾信息科技有限公司
¥38立即购买
查看详情- AI绘画
- 图片处理
- 图片转换
- AI绘画生成器
RAG实践指南:本地部署Ollama与RagFlow构建知识库
简介:本文将深入探讨RAG实践,具体介绍如何利用Ollama与RagFlow在本地环境中部署知识库,同时分析其中遇到的主要难点,并提供解决方案与领域的未来展望。
在人工智能与知识图谱日益融合的背景下,RAG(Retrieval-Augmented Generation)技术成为了实现高效知识检索与生成的关键。特别是当Ollama与RagFlow这两个工具结合时,它们为在本地环境中构建和部署知识库提供了强大的支持。本文将围绕RAG实践,阐述如何在本地成功部署Ollama+RagFlow来构建知识库,并探讨相关技术的痛点、解决方案以及未来趋势。
一、RAG实践的核心与难点
RAG实践的核心在于通过检索增强生成模型的能力,使其能够基于广泛的知识库进行更准确、更丰富的信息输出。然而,这一过程中存在几个显著的难点:
- 数据整合与管理:构建有效的知识库首先需要对大量数据进行整合、清洗和标注,这是一个既耗时又技术密集的过程。
- 本地化部署的复杂性:与云端服务相比,本地部署需要考虑更多的硬件兼容性、软件配置以及网络安全问题。
- 性能优化:确保检索速度和生成质量的平衡是RAG系统的关键挑战,特别是在处理大规模知识库时。
二、Ollama+RagFlow的本地部署解决方案
针对上述难点,Ollama与RagFlow的结合为本地知识库的构建与部署提供了有力的支持:
- 强大的数据整合能力:Ollama提供了灵活的数据导入和处理模块,使得从不同来源整合数据成为可能。同时,RagFlow的流式处理机制能够有效应对数据清洗和标注的挑战。
- 简化的本地部署流程:借助详细的文档和社区支持,这两个工具的结合使得本地部署变得相对简单,减少了对专业和复杂IT支撑团队的依赖。
- 高效的性能调优:RagFlow的异步处理和缓存机制显著提升了检索速度,而Ollama的优化算法则在保持生成质量的同时降低了计算资源消耗。
三、案例说明:本地知识库的具体应用
以某大型企业的内部知识管理系统为例,通过Ollama+RagFlow的本地部署,该系统实现了以下功能:
- 快速文档检索:员工能够通过自然语言查询快速检索到相关文档,提高了工作效率。
- 智能问答助手:系统能够根据用户提问自动生成答复,辅助解决常见问题。
- 个性化知识推荐:基于用户的历史行为,系统能够智能推荐相关知识和信息。
四、领域前瞻:RAG实践的未来发展
随着技术的不断进步,RAG实践及其相关的Ollama+RagFlow部署在未来的发展中呈现出几个潜在的趋势:
- 更广泛的行业应用:除了企业知识管理,RAG技术有望在教育、医疗等领域得到更广泛的应用。
- 更强大的跨模态检索:未来RAG系统可能支持图像、视频等非文本模态的检索与生成。
- 更高的智能化水平:借助深度学习和强化学习技术,RAG系统有望在自主性、适应性和交互性方面取得显著进步。
综上所述,RAG实践,特别是通过Ollama+RagFlow在本地环境中部署知识库,不仅提高了信息检索与生成的效率和准确性,还为各行业的智能化转型提供了新的可能。通过不断的技术创新和应用探索,我们相信这一领域将迎来更加广阔的发展前景。